Hello! I want to duplicate the sound of two rifles firing simultaneously. How do I do that?

Not sure what you're asking exactly.
Here's my guess.

A) You're playing back two sounds on freesound.org and having them overlaid is a thing you like and would like to "resample" them into one sound?
-Download them, and download audacity, overlay them in that software and export the sound.

B) You want to duplicate A sound, and offset it to itself to have a sort of echo effect.
-Download the sound and audacity, load the same sound twice, adjust timing to your preference. Export.
